The following histogram displays the number of books on the x -axis and the frequency … WebThe associated numbers of sheep, milligrams of caffeine, and exports are the continuous variables. You might argue that number of sheep is not a continuous variable, as you can’t really have a fractional sheep. However, ggplot2 treats integers and doubles as continuous variables, and treats only factors, characters, and logicals as discrete.
